President Mitch Daniels, state Rep. Sheila Klinker, West Lafayette Mayor John Dennis and others take part in the ribbon cutting for Another Broken Egg Café on Tuesday (Aug. 25) in Seng-Liang Wang Hall.

The restaurant, known for its omelets, pancakes, burgers and salads, is the first to open in Wang Hall, a public/private building of 147,000-square-foot owned by the Purdue Research Foundation. Wang Hall also houses facilities for the School of Electrical and Computer Engineering, other Purdue academic and administrative offices and a branch of the Purdue Federal Credit Union.

Another Broken Egg Café occupies 3,350-square-feet in Wang Hall with indoor seating for 100 and space for 24 more on an outside patio.
